MOSCOW – Russia will push for the lifting of an economic embargo against the Palestinian government,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ov said Tuesday during a visit by Hamas political director Khaled Meshaal.
“˜We are striving to have the international community support the peace process and make it irrevocable, including helping end the blockade” against the Palestianian government, Lavrov told journalists.
The so-called Middle East diplomatic Quartet — Russia, the United States, the European Union and the United Nations — imposed the sanctions after Hamas took control of the Palestinian government in elections last January and refused to recognize Israel or renounce violence.
Meshaal met Lavrov on the second day of a visit to Moscow aimed at marshalling support to lift the crippling sanctions, and said Russia was the next logical destination after Hamas and rival party Fatah struck a power-sharing agreement in Mecca earlier this month.
“˜From the very beginning we wanted to make Moscow the first place we visited after the talks in Mecca in order to consult with you about steps that need to be taken after the Mecca agreement,” Meshaal said.
